This beach is located at the end of an abandoned sugarcane field. You will drive through the sugarcane field; keep driving and you will get to the beach - it will feel like you are driving in circles ( that's the way we felt, but you will get there). Once you do, it's an amazing sight! You are at the beginning of the Na Pali coast on the southern end. It's much hotter on this coast vs. the northern end. The surf is rough here, so if you are not a strong swimmer, watch from the sand! The waves are good for body-surfing! This beach is reported to be haunted. You can also camp here - make sure to get a permit!
